HI FLY becomes the world’s first airline without any single-use plastic items on-board. 
The leading wet-lease carrier has worked hard to replace plastic with bamboo cutlery, cups, spoons, and salt and pepper shakers, while packaging for bedding, dishes, individual butter pots, soft drink bottles, and toothbrushes were switched with compostable alternatives crafted from recycled material.

NOAA Reports Magnetic North is Moving
Why should you care where magnetic north is located? If you own a compass, GPS, or any other device dependent on the earth’s magnetic poles for information, they become inaccurate when magnetic north relocates. For any GPS, and this includes the ones on airplanes and ships critical for navigation, the correction is accomplished in the software.
However, Cork (Ireland) Airport and Geneva, Switzerland, have renamed their runways - to keep up with Earth's magnetic poles. Zurich, Switzerland airport might be the next, among many others.

Austrian Airlines: Route Expansion in Canada






Austrian Airlines expands their Air Canada - Montreal codeshare routes from April 2019 on. 

Austrian Airlines has announced a new, year-round daily flight to Montréal (YUL).  It will launch from its base in Vienna.  This new flight to YUL means that the Lufthansa Group, to which Austrian Airlines belong, offers numerous flights to the Quebec region.
.

Planned codeshare routes from 29 April 2019:
Montreal – Calgary 
Montreal – Halifax 
Montreal – Ottawa
Montreal – Vancouver
Montreal – Winnipeg

The service will be operated by the carrier’s Boeing 767-300(ER) aircraft on a daily basis throughout the Summer, and then five times per week during the Winter season.




With this change, Austrian, Lufthansa, and Swiss will all be flying to Montreal, from Frankfurt, Munich, Vienna, and Zurich.  Austrian has a fairly small long-haul fleet, so not surprisingly, this new route is coming at the expense of another destination.  Austrian will discontinue flights between Vienna and Toronto as of April 2019.

Austrian Airlines AG, sometimes shortened to Austrian, is the flag carrier of Austria and a subsidiary of the Lufthansa Group.
